上回解读了 #BTC 为什么每四年减半一次。今天聊一聊为什么BTC总量是2100万,其实这是一个简单的数学题。 BTC大约每10分钟(这个10分钟的设定应该是技术上的考虑。如果出块太快,消耗就太大了,因为每出一个块,所有的矿机都要进行大量的哈希运算。如果出块太慢,那可能影响比特币网络的工作效率)产生一个区块。21万个区块的时间是1458天零8个小时,差不多就是4年时间。 最初每个区块链奖励50枚BTC,每21万个区块奖励减半,所以比特币网络的总产出就等于 50*210000+25*210000+12.5*210000+…… 等比数列求极限,就等于(50*210000)/(1-0.5)=2100万 在EXCEL可以列出数据绘制图表。在产量图中,可以看出,BTC产量是一个接近封闭的图形,面积是2100万不太明显。下面这个BTC总量图就非常明显了,无限接近2100万。 BTC的数学之美!